#b72203 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#b72203 is composed of 71.8% red, 13.3% green and 1.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 81.4% magenta, 98.4% yellow and 28.2% black. It has a hue angle of 10.3 degrees, a saturation of 96.8% and a lightness of 36.5%. #b72203 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ff4406 with #6f0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3300.

Shades and Tints of #b72203

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090200 is the darkest color, while #fff7f5 is the lightest one.

Tones of #b72203

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#615a59 is the less saturated color, while #b72203 is the most saturated one.
